Sorry, just to clarify...
4.0 42RE
5.2 44RH
5.9 46RE
The 44RH is not that bad of a trans, from what I hear anyways. You can also convert the 46RE to the 4.o but this tranny still has it's issues..
If I had it my way, I'd go with a 5.9, but it's only offered in 98.
Most would advise to go with a least a 5.2 for the ZJ, the difference in gas in only ~3.5mpg, or something liie that..
